
About this episode
Matt Higgins, guest shark on Shark Tank, co-founder and CEO of private investment firm RSE Ventures, executive fellow at Harvard Business School, and author, shares how to make yourself indispensable, why opportunity is a leading indicator and compensation is a lagging indicator, and the importance of constantly broadening your brand and skill set.
Hear Matt's full interview across Episodes 415 and 416 of The Action Catalyst.
